• People

Credits

Cast

Kevin Cheng Ka-Wing

Kevin Cheng Ka-Wing

Doctor Lam

Dada Chan

Dada Chan

Rebecca Zhu

Rebecca Zhu

Helena Law Lan

Helena Law Lan

Edmond So Chi-Wai

Edmond So Chi-Wai

Crew

Karl Tam Ka-Ho

Cinematography

Directing

Jack Wong

Jack Wong

Action Director

Benny Lau Wai-Hang

Benny Lau Wai-Hang

Director

Editing

Chow Kai-Pong

Chow Kai-Pong

Editor

Production

Mak Ho-Pong

Mak Ho-Pong

Executive Producer

Raymond Wong Pak-Ming

Raymond Wong Pak-Ming

Producer

Sound

Alan Wong Ngai-Lun

Original Music Composer

Janet Yung Wai-Ying

Original Music Composer

Writing

Edmond Wong Chi-Mun

Edmond Wong Chi-Mun

Screenplay

Copyright © 2025 Film Snail. All Rights Reserved.

The Movie Database

This website uses TMDB and the TMDB APIs but is not endorsed, certified, or otherwise approved by TMDB.